For many parents, back-to-school time can be a little stressful with all the changes to a child’s routine: earlier bedtimes, a more rushed morning routine, after-school activities, and homework. Then there’s the added responsibility of making school lunches that are healthy, nut free, and—most importantly—delicious! You know it’s a success when your child brings home an empty lunchbox, because they’ve eaten every last bite (not because they’ve traded it with someone else)! I’ve created a week’s worth of yummy and wholesome lunchbox ideas that are easy to prep and won’t break the bank. The recipes that require a little more prep can easily be made ahead of time, say on a Sunday afternoon when you can do it together. Making recipes with your kids is a great way to get them interested in healthy eating. It’s also a wonderful time for you, as a parent, to connect with your children and have some fun while you’re at it!
